Daniel GORAK and Katarzyna GRZYBOWSKA clinched the titles in their respective Men’s and Women’s Singles Event at the 82nd Polish National Championships held last weekend.

GRZYBOWSKA won her first title and National championships by beating last year’s winner Antonina SZYMAŃSKA in straight games. GORAK overcame Bartosz SUCH in five games in the final.

82nd Polish Championships Results

Men Singles: 1. GÓRAK Daniel; 2. SUCH Bartosz; 3-4. CHOJNOWSKI Patryk FERTIKOWSKI Paweł; 5-8. LEWANDOWSKI Tomasz FLORAS Robert SZARMACH Karol KOSOWSKI Jakub

Women Singles: 1. GRZYBOWSKA Katarzyna 2. SZYMAŃSKA Antonina 3-4. ŁUCZAKOWSKADaria BAJOR Natalia. 5-8: SIKORSKA Magdalena PARTYKA Natalia GOŁOTA Marta GUMULA Renata

Women Doubles: 1. GRZYBOWSKA Katarzyna/PARTYKA Natalia 2. DONG RUI Fang/KUSIŃSKA Klaudia 3-4. STEFAŃSKA Kinga/ZAŁOMSKA Roksana BAJOR Natalia/ WABIK Sandra

Men Doubles: 1.DYJAS Jakub/KULPA Konrad 2.NOWOKUŃSKI Jacek/PEREK Jakub 3-4. CHMIEL Paweł /CHMIEL Piotr ADAMIAK Grzegorz/ CZERNIAWSKI Marcin

Mixed Doubles: 1. PEREK Jakub/SIKORSKA Magdalena; 2. KULPA Konrad/7 KUSIŃSKA Klaudia; 3-4. FERTIKOWSKI Paweł/GRZYBOWSKA Katarzyna DYJAS Jakub/ GOŁOTA Marta
